The Far Eastern University Lady Tamaraws bounced back in UAAP Season 88 women’s volleyball by defeating the Adamson Lady Falcons in four sets, 22‑25, 30‑28, 25‑17, 25‑20, on Sunday at the Smart Araneta Coliseum.
FEU dropped the first set but fought back, with an extended second‑set victory turning the momentum in their favor.
Faida Bakanke led the Lady Tamaraws with 22 points, including 17 successful attacks and five blocks, while Alyzza Devosora contributed 18 points alongside strong defensive numbers.
Adamson’s Shaina Nitura put up a strong performance with 24 points, but it wasn’t enough as FEU rallied to secure the win and snap their recent loss.
